Do each app need to manually integrate with another app to be considered federated or is any app using ActivityPub automatically integrated to your app?

ActivityPub provides the framework, but a platform also has to be designed to support another platform. It's not automatic.

I've been using LED bulbs for a good number of years, I've only had one or two die on me. The longevity alone makes them much better than incandescent, but then they use a tenth the power.

My favorite is the A15 Edison style. That's the appliance size, smaller than the standard A19. The A15 fits in everything so I only need to stock one size.
